Top UI/UX Design Tips for eCommerce Websites

Top UI/UX Design Tips for eCommerce Websites

Ever found yourself abandoning an online shopping cart because the website was just too frustrating to navigate? You’re not alone. In the fast-paced world of eCommerce, a well-designed user interface (UI) and user experience (UX) can make all the difference between a sale and a missed opportunity.

Imagine browsing a site that’s visually appealing, easy to use, and intuitively guides you to exactly what you’re looking for. Sounds like a dream, right? With the right UI/UX design tips, you can turn your eCommerce website into a user-friendly shopping haven that keeps customers coming back for more. Let’s jump into some practical tips to elevate your site’s design and boost those conversion rates.

Table of Contents

Key Takeaways

  • Optimize User Experience: Prioritize smooth navigation, effective search functionality, and engaging product displays to enhance user satisfaction and reduce cart abandonment.
  • High-Quality Visuals: Use professional images and detailed product descriptions to build trust and drive sales, as customers rely heavily on visuals for purchase decisions.
  • Mobile Responsiveness: Ensure your eCommerce site is mobile-friendly, offering a seamless experience across all devices by optimizing design and load speeds.
  • Fast Page Load Times: Improve site performance with techniques like image compression, CDN deployment, and reducing HTTP requests to prevent user frustration and boost conversion rates.
  • Personalized Engagement: Incorporate user-generated content and tailored recommendations to create a customer-centric experience, fostering loyalty and repeat purchases.

Assessing Your Current UI/UX Design

Evaluating your existing UI/UX design helps improve user experience and boosts your eCommerce website’s performance. Use these strategies to audit your site effectively.

Conducting a User Experience Audit

Start by examining your site for any areas that hinder user experience. Identify elements that may frustrate users or slow down their journey. Look into navigation, search functionality, and product pages to ensure a smooth process.

Identifying Areas for Improvement

Product Search and Browse

1. Optimize Search Functionality:

Ensure your on-site search feature is easy to use. Users should find products quickly and accurately.

2. Carry out Filters and Faceted Search:

Add filters and faceted search options to help users narrow down their choices. This makes browsing more efficient.

3. Highlight Primary Actions:

Prominently display primary actions like “Add to Cart”. This guides users toward completing purchases.

4. Use High-Quality Product Images:

Include clear, high-resolution images for all products. Customers rely on visuals to make purchasing decisions.

5. Provide Detailed Descriptions:

Offer thorough product descriptions. Detailed information builds trust and helps users understand what they’re buying.

Essential UI/UX Design Tips for Ecommerce Websites

Use High-Quality Product Images and Detailed Descriptions

Display high-quality product images to help buyers understand what they’re purchasing. Professional photos can reveal product details, build trust, and drive sales. Use multiple angles and close-ups to provide a comprehensive view.

Supplement these images with detailed descriptions. Include specifics like dimensions, materials, and care instructions. For example, an online clothing store might detail fabric types and washing instructions. This ensures consumers have all necessary information, reducing returns and improving satisfaction.

Carry out Progressive Disclosure and Visual Hierarchy

Organize content using progressive disclosure, where necessary information reveals itself as needed. This approach prevents overwhelming users, helping them focus on immediate tasks. For example, show essential product details first, with additional information accessible through tabs or expansions.

Visual hierarchy guides users’ attention to primary actions and critical details. Employ larger fonts and bold colors for key actions like “Add to Cart” and use whitespace to separate sections, enhancing readability and navigation.

Optimize On-Site Search

Provide an effective site-wide search function to help users find products quickly. Carry out features like predictive search and autocomplete. Predictive search suggests relevant products as users type, reducing effort and speeding up the process.

For instance, if someone types “red shoes,” immediate suggestions should appear. Ensure the search is forgiving of typos and synonyms to improve user experience. A well-optimized search boosts usability and encourages purchases by making product discovery effortless.

Incorporate User-Centric Navigation

Design intuitive navigation structures that enable users to find products with minimal effort. Use clear, descriptive labels for categories and subcategories. Include breadcrumb trails so users can easily trace back their steps. If you’re having issues with navigation, consider investing in UI and UX design services to create a smoother, more user-friendly experience.

A web store selling electronics might categorize by product type (e.g., smartphones, laptops) and further subcategorize by brand. Simplifying navigation reduces friction, helping customers locate products swiftly and efficiently.

Ensure Mobile Responsiveness

Given the increasing use of mobile devices for online shopping, ensure your ecommerce site is fully responsive. A responsive design adapts to various screen sizes, providing an optimal viewing experience. Test and optimize mobile usability by ensuring touch-friendly navigation, streamlined content, and fast load times.

An example is simplifying the checkout process for mobile users by using larger buttons and autofill features. Mobile responsiveness increases accessibility and keeps potential buyers engaged regardless of their device.

Optimizing Page Load Times

Importance of Page Load Times

Optimizing page load times is crucial for ecommerce websites because it impacts user experience, conversion rates, and sales revenue. Data shows that 70% of consumers admit a slow-loading website affects their willingness to buy from an online retailer. Besides, 57% of online consumers abandon a site after waiting 3 seconds for a page to load. Notably, the average conversion rate for an ecommerce store decreases by 0.3% for every extra second it takes for the website to load.

Techniques to Achieve Blazing-Fast Ecommerce Site Speed

Site Architecture

  • Use Headless Commerce: Detach the front-end from the back-end platform to reduce complexity and improve speed.
  • Commerce Components by Shopify: Load only necessary ecommerce technologies to reduce the load on browsers.

Content Delivery Network (CDN)

Deploying a CDN ensures your content is distributed across multiple servers globally. It helps decrease server response times by delivering content from the nearest server location to the user. Services like Cloudflare and Amazon CloudFront offer excellent performance improvements.

Image Optimization

  • Compress Images: Use tools like TinyPNG or ImageOptim to compress images without compromising quality.
  • Carry out Lazy Loading: Load images only when they are about to enter the viewport. This reduces initial page load time.

Minify and Combine Files

  • Minify CSS and JavaScript: Use tools like UglifyJS and CSSNano to remove unnecessary characters from code.
  • Combine Files: Reduce HTTP requests by combining multiple CSS and JavaScript files into single files where possible.

Caching Mechanisms

Carry out caching to store copies of your website’s files. Browser caching stores static files in a user’s browser, allowing subsequent page loads to fetch files locally rather than from the server. Tools like WP Super Cache and W3 Total Cache can be beneficial for ecommerce platforms.

Reducing HTTP Requests

Reduce the number of HTTP requests on your site. This can be achieved by simplifying the site’s design and limiting the use of multiple plugins and scripts. Consolidate all CSS and JavaScript files and use sprite sheets for images where applicable.

Testing and Monitoring

Regularly test and monitor your website’s speed performance. Use tools like Google PageSpeed Insights and GTmetrix to identify areas that need improvement. Continual monitoring ensures your site remains optimized as new content and features are added.

Designing for Mobile First

Designing for mobile first ensures your ecommerce website provides a seamless user experience on smartphones, expanding your reach to a broader audience.

Responsive vs. Adaptive Designs

Responsive and adaptive designs cater to different screen sizes and devices, enhancing user experience.

  1. Responsive Design: Responsive design adjusts layout and content fluidly, ensuring your website looks good on any device. By using flexible grids and media queries, the layout adapts to the screen size. A responsive ecommerce site resizes images and text, ensuring readability and usability. For example, an image gallery might display in a single column on mobile but expand to multiple columns on a desktop.
  2. Adaptive Design: Adaptive design, on the other hand, uses static layouts based on specific screen sizes. Your website will load a version that matches the user’s device. Adaptive designs often involve creating several fixed layouts, each catering to different screen widths. For instance, a product page might show fewer images and a simplified navigation menu on a mobile layout compared to more comprehensive options on a desktop version.

Prioritize Mobile-Friendly Design

Optimized mobile-friendly design focuses on usability on smartphones.

  • Intuitive Design: Ensure the design is intuitive, minimizing user effort to navigate. Use large, easily tappable buttons and clear icons to enhance usability.
  • Speed: Increase site speed by minimizing heavy design elements and optimizing images. A smoother experience encourages longer browsing and higher conversion rates.

Streamline Navigation

Simplified navigation helps users find products easily.

  • Clear Menus: Use clear, straightforward menus. Avoid clutter to help users find categories and products quickly.
  • Accessibility: Ensure essential elements like search bars and call-to-action buttons are easy to access. Position them prominently to improve usability.

Optimize Page Load Speed

Fast page load speeds enhance the shopping experience.

  • Lightweight Design: Avoid heavy elements like parallax scrolling and video backgrounds. Focus on lightweight design for quicker load times.
  • Optimization Techniques: Employ techniques like image compression and file minification. Regularly test site performance with tools like Google PageSpeed Insights to identify areas for improvement.

By prioritizing mobile-first principles, your ecommerce website will cater well to the growing number of mobile users, ensuring a smooth and engaging shopping experience.

Enhancing User Engagement

To captivate visitors and convert them into customers, enhancing user engagement on your ecommerce site is crucial. Focusing on intuitive design and interactive elements can boost user satisfaction and loyalty.

Using High-Quality Images and Videos

Showcase Products Attractively:

Images of products should be clear and high-resolution. Provide multiple angles to give users a comprehensive view. Incorporate zoom functionality to allow closer inspection.

Use Videos for Deeper Insights:

Videos can demonstrate product features, offer usage tips, or tell the brand story. Example: A fashion retailer might use short videos to show how an outfit looks when worn, providing a dynamic view that static images can’t.

Include Customer Reviews and Testimonials:

Visual reviews like unboxing videos or customer-generated content can add authenticity. Positive visuals from real users build trust and can drive purchasing decisions.

Simplify Form Fields:

Minimize the number of required fields to speed up the checkout process. Collect only essential information to avoid cart abandonment.

Offer Multiple Payment Options:

Provide various payment methods such as credit cards, PayPal, and digital wallets. Example: Offering options like Apple Pay or Google Wallet can cater to a broader audience, increasing the likelihood of completing sales.

Enable Guest Checkout:

Allow users to make purchases without creating an account. This reduces friction and can significantly improve conversion rates.

Provide Clear Progress Indicators:

Carry out progress bars to show users how many steps are left in the checkout process. This transparency reduces anxiety and encourages completion.

By incorporating these strategies, you enhance user engagement, leading to higher satisfaction and increased sales on your ecommerce platform.

Effective Product Display and Descriptions

High-Quality Product Images

Use high-quality, professional photos that showcase the product from multiple angles. Ensure images are clear, well-lit, and in focus to help customers understand the product. Display products with varied backgrounds and contexts to add depth and perspective.

Detailed Product Descriptions

Provide detailed, accurate descriptions including features, materials, and dimensions. Clear and concise language helps customers make informed purchasing decisions. Describe unique attributes and benefits of the product to differentiate it from competitors.

Product Page Structure

Structure product information logically and make it easy to read. Use headings, bullet points, and short paragraphs to make content scannable. Highlight key points using bold text or icons. Include tabs or accordions for additional details without overwhelming users.

Personalization and Customer Interaction

Personalization significantly enhances user experience on eCommerce websites by tailoring interactions to individual preferences. This section covers how to achieve this through user-generated content and tailored recommendations.

Incorporating User-Generated Content

Incorporating reviews and testimonials from your customers increases engagement and builds trust. Potential buyers often rely on the experiences of others to make purchasing decisions. Include product reviews, ratings, and customer photos on product pages. For example, Amazon’s inclusion of user reviews and Q&A sections has been instrumental in building consumer trust.

Displaying customer testimonials prominently on landing pages and using star ratings for products can guide new customers in their decision-making process. This helps create a community-like atmosphere where customers feel valued and heard.

Tailored Recommendations and Offers

Providing tailored recommendations and offers based on user behavior and preferences can significantly boost engagement and conversion rates. Analyze browsing history and purchase patterns to suggest products that align with individual tastes. Streaming service Netflix serves as a prime example of leveraging user data to present personalized content.

Offer personalized discounts and promotions via email campaigns to encourage repeat purchases. Ensure emails address customers by name and reference previous purchases or browsed items. Dynamic landing pages that adapt content based on user location or search terms enhance relevance, so improving user satisfaction.

Integrating these personalized strategies into your eCommerce website creates a seamless, customer-centric experience that fosters loyalty and boosts sales.

Common UI/UX Mistakes to Avoid

When designing an eCommerce website, avoiding common UI/UX mistakes is crucial to enhance user experience and drive conversions. Here are the most frequent pitfalls and how to steer clear of them:

Overwhelming Users with Choices

Too many options can overwhelm users and lead to decision paralysis.

  • Avoid Information Overload: Ensure that the interface is clean and uncluttered. For example, limit the number of products shown on a single page. Group related items instead of displaying everything at once.
  • Streamline Navigation: Organize content logically and intuitively. Use clear categories for browsing, like “Men’s Apparel” and “Women’s Shoes.” Dropdown menus and breadcrumb trails can help users quickly find what they’re looking for.

Ignoring Accessibility Standards

Accessibility ensures that all users, including those with disabilities, have a seamless experience on your site.

  • Ensure Accessibility: Design for users with disabilities by following guidelines like the Web Content Accessibility Guidelines (WCAG). Use high-contrast colors, scalable fonts, and alt text for images to aid screen readers.
  • Test for Accessibility: Conduct user testing with individuals who need assistive technologies. Software like WAVE and Axe can help identify and fix accessibility issues. Regularly updating and testing your site ensures it remains accessible over time.

A/B Testing for Design Website Changes

Understanding A/B Testing

A/B testing, also called split testing, lets you compare two versions of your website to see which performs better. You divide your users into two groups. Each group sees a different version of the site. You then measure performance based on criteria like page views, clicks, subscriptions, or sales leads.

Importance in Ecommerce

A/B testing’s vital for ecommerce because it enhances the shopping experience. Better click-through rates, conversions, and loyalty emerge from these improvements. Data-driven decisions help you while making changes. You uncover insights guiding these changes to your site.

Key Steps for Effective A/B Testing

  1. Identify Goals: Start with clear, measurable goals. Examples include increasing sign-ups, boosting sales, or improving engagement metrics. Clear goals help you determine what to test.
  2. Create Hypotheses: Develop hypotheses based on user behavior and feedback. For instance, you might believe changing the color of a call-to-action button will increase clicks.
  3. Design Variants: Design two versions of the element you want to test. One is the control (original), and the other is the variant (new version).
  4. Run the Test: Split your users into two groups. Ensure random distribution to avoid biases. Each group sees one version of the element.
  5. Measure Results: Collect data on performance metrics. Tools like Google Analytics or Optimizely help you track results. Compare metrics to see which version performs better.
  6. Analyze Data: Analyze the test outcome. Identify trends and insights. Determine whether to carry out changes or run further tests.


Ensure that your branding is clear and consistent throughout the website to build trust and recognition with customers. Incorporate your logo, brand colors, and unique design elements on every page. Hyundai’s e-commerce website, for example, keeps its branding consistent with the use of the brand’s signature blue color and logo.

Set Clear Navigation

Simplify navigation to make it easy for users to find what they need. Use clear labels for categories and subcategories, and consider adding a breadcrumb trail for easier navigation. Amazon excels in this, with its categorized menu that guides users seamlessly to their desired products.

Use Gamification

Integrate gamification elements like challenges, leaderboards, and rewards to stimulate user engagement. For instance, Zappos offers a points system for completing different actions, encouraging repeat purchases and enhancing user involvement.

Optimize Landing Pages

Use specific landing pages to focus user attention and reduce distractions. Highlight key product features and benefits clearly. Shopify’s product-specific landing pages serve as excellent examples by concentrating solely on what each product offers, thereby boosting conversion rates.

Make the Homepage Informative

Include essential information on the homepage, such as brand identity, internal search, and core interaction zones. Walmart’s homepage effectively presents the brand identity, provides a search bar, and displays popular products, ensuring a positive user experience.

Additional Tips

  1. High-Quality Images: Use clear, high-resolution images to showcase products.
  2. Detailed Descriptions: Provide comprehensive product descriptions, including specifications and benefits.
  3. Optimize Load Times: Carry out strategies like Headless Commerce and CDNs to ensure fast site speed.
  4. Personalization: Use user-generated content and tailored recommendations to enhance the shopping experience.
  5. A/B Testing: Regularly conduct A/B tests on design changes to improve metrics like click-through rates and conversions.


By focusing on clear branding, simple navigation, engaging gamification, targeted landing pages, and an informative homepage, your e-commerce site can provide a seamless user experience. Use these UI/UX design tips to transform casual visitors into loyal customers, enhancing your overall conversion rates and user retention.


By focusing on UI and UX design, your eCommerce site can truly stand out. It’s not just about aesthetics; it’s about creating a seamless and enjoyable shopping experience. Implementing strategies like clear branding, simple navigation, and engaging content can make a significant difference.

Remember to keep testing and optimizing. A/B testing can help you understand what works best for your audience. High-quality images and detailed descriptions are essential, but don’t forget the power of personalization and gamification to keep users engaged.

By following these tips, you’ll not only attract visitors but also turn them into loyal customers. Happy designing!

Frequently Asked Questions

Why is a well-designed UI/UX crucial for eCommerce?

A well-designed UI/UX is essential in eCommerce because it enhances user satisfaction and engagement, making it easier for visitors to navigate the site, find products, and complete purchases. This can lead to higher conversion rates and customer loyalty.

How can high-quality images impact an eCommerce website?

High-quality images provide a clear and detailed view of products, which can help build trust with customers. They allow shoppers to better judge the quality and appearance of items, potentially increasing sales and reducing return rates.

What role do detailed product descriptions play in eCommerce?

Detailed product descriptions give shoppers essential information about items, helping them make informed buying decisions. Comprehensive descriptions can reduce customer queries and returns, leading to a smoother shopping experience.

What is Headless Commerce and how does it benefit eCommerce?

Headless Commerce separates the front end from the backend, allowing for more flexibility in design and user experience. It helps eCommerce sites quickly adapt to new technologies and platforms, providing a seamless shopping experience across various devices.

How does a Content Delivery Network (CDN) improve page load times?

A CDN stores copies of your website’s content on multiple servers worldwide, reducing the distance data needs to travel to reach users. This speeds up page load times, enhancing user experience and potentially boosting SEO rankings.

What is the importance of personalization in eCommerce?

Personalization, through user-generated content and tailored recommendations, makes shopping experiences more relevant to individual users. It increases customer engagement, satisfaction, and conversion rates by showing products that match users’ preferences and behaviors.

How can clear branding enhance the user experience?

Clear branding ensures consistency across all customer touchpoints, building trust and recognition. A strong brand identity helps customers easily navigate and relate to the website, which can increase loyalty and repeat purchases.

Why is simple navigation important for eCommerce websites?

Simple navigation helps users find products and information quickly and easily. It reduces frustration and the time spent searching, leading to a better user experience and higher likelihood of conversions.

What is gamification and how can it be used in eCommerce?

Gamification involves adding game-like elements (such as points, badges, or challenges) to engage and motivate customers. It makes shopping more enjoyable and encourages repeat visits, boosting customer retention.

How do targeted landing pages improve user retention?

Targeted landing pages are tailored to specific audience segments or marketing campaigns. They present relevant content and offers, increasing the likelihood of conversions and keeping users engaged with the site.

Why is an informative homepage essential for eCommerce sites?

An informative homepage sets the tone for the entire website, providing key information about products, offers, and brand values. It helps users quickly understand what the site offers, improving their overall experience and likelihood to explore further.

What is A/B testing and why is it important for UI/UX design changes?

A/B testing involves comparing two versions of a webpage to determine which one performs better. It helps identify design changes that positively impact user behavior, such as higher click-through rates and conversions, allowing for data-driven decisions in UI/UX improvements.


Related Posts